The bounce processor maintains a session per provider webhook stream, rotating every 30 minutes to limit replay exposure. Hard bounces invalidate the associated delivery session immediately; soft bounces decrement a retry counter stored alongside the session record. For the upcoming release, verify that session rotation does not drop in-flight bounce events — the queue drain must complete before teardown. Release validation scripts call the admin API directly and must authenticate; use the pre-release token provided below.

portal login ticket: eyJhbGciOiJIUzI1NiIsInR5cCI6IkpXVCJ9.eyJzdWIiOiIwEOsktwVNwIn0.-UJU3fdyyCgG

Waveform previews in Soundlathe are rendered server-side, not in your plugin. Submit the asset handle to the preview endpoint; it returns peak data at your requested resolution, capped at 4096 buckets. Do not decode audio locally — it breaks sandbox limits and fails review. Cache responses; peaks are immutable per asset version. Polling for render status is allowed at 2s intervals. Requests authenticate against the internal Peaks service with the key below.

API key for tagug-tajef: vxb4-R1fo

**Q: Why does the Striderline chip reader occasionally log duplicate finish times?**

A: The mat antennas overlap near the finish arch, so a runner's chip can be read by two loops within the dedupe window. The reader firmware collapses duplicates within 400 ms, but clock drift between mats can defeat this. Maintainers should verify NTP sync before each event; the full dedupe procedure is documented internally.

operations page: https://jenkins.zemvarcloud.local/job/merge_requests/repo/build/73930b4b30f0a8ed

Hey Rasha,

Quick handover before I log off. The Pointstack ledger had a reconciliation drift around midday — about 40 accounts showed duplicate accrual rows after the Fennel batch job retried. I re-ran the dedupe script and numbers match again, but keep an eye on the `accrual_lag` dashboard tonight. If support escalates anything about missing points, it's probably stale cache, not the ledger itself. Questions overnight should go to the address below.

Cheers,
Tomas

escalation mailbox, hadug-bajog: sormir@norvalabs.internal